I was checking out a thread on ResetERA and someone mentioned how fitting it was that RE2 Remake is small and nicely compressed, and the N64 RE2 port was also something of a miracle in compression. They posted this RE2 postmortem, which I thought was pretty fascinating. We all know about the work the group put into porting the game, but I'd never seen the breakdown and thought process, which this goes into. Interesting stuff. http://www.gamasutra.com/view/feature/131556/postmortem_angel_studios_.php Game Stats Publisher: Capcom Number of full-time developers: 9 Number of contractors: 1 Budget: $1,000,000 Length of development: 12 months Release date: November 16, 1999 Development hardware used: SN Systems' SN64 Development software used: Visual SlickEdit, gcc, Debabalizer, Photoshop, Softimage Notable technologies: Our proprietary N64 OS and FMV compression and playback system Total lines of code: approximately 200,000 Link to post Share on other sites
